Siemens 6ED1055-1FB00-0BA2 — A Procurement Officer’s Guide to Securing LOGO! DM8 24 Expansion Modules
When a production line halts because a single I/O expansion module fails, the cost is rarely limited to the component itself. Downtime, emergency freight, expedited sourcing fees, and technician overtime compound rapidly. The Siemens 6ED1055-1FB00-0BA2 — commercially designated the LOGO! DM8 24 — is a 4-digital-input / 4-digital-output transistor expansion module operating at 24 V DC. It is a high-frequency replacement part across building automation, conveyor systems, pump control panels, and OEM machinery. Understanding how to source it strategically is as important as understanding its technical function.

Procurement Specifications
| Part Number | 6ED1055-1FB00-0BA2 |
| Commercial Designation | LOGO! DM8 24 |
| Manufacturer | Siemens AG |
| Series | LOGO! Expansion Module (0BA8 Generation) |
| Supply Voltage | 24 V DC |
| Digital Inputs | 4 × 24 V DC |
| Digital Outputs | 4 × Transistor (solid-state), 0.3 A per channel |
| Total I/O Points | 8 (4DI + 4DO) |
| Output Type | Transistor (PNP, short-circuit protected) |
| Connection Method | Screw terminal |
| Mounting | 35 mm DIN rail |
| Dimensions (W×H×D) | 36 × 90 × 55 mm |
| Weight | Approx. 230 g |
| Protection Rating | IP20 |
| Operating Temperature | 0 °C to +55 °C |
| Storage Temperature | −40 °C to +70 °C |
| Certifications | CE, UL, cULus, ATEX Zone 2 |
| Compatible Base Units | LOGO! 0BA7, 0BA8 series |
| Country of Origin | Germany |
| HS Code Reference | 8537.10 (programmable controllers and I/O modules) |

4. Counterfeit and Compatibility Risk (Hidden CAPEX)
The LOGO! expansion bus uses a proprietary interface. A counterfeit or misrepresented module may appear functional during bench testing but fail under thermal load or cause bus communication errors that corrupt the base unit’s program execution. The cost of diagnosing and recovering from a counterfeit-induced system fault — including engineering hours, potential damage to connected field devices, and repeat downtime — routinely exceeds the cost of the original component by a factor of 10 to 50.
